Marbella - Fascinating Fact 1

Gastro-town

Marbella has three one-Michelin-starred restaurants , the most famous of which is Dani Garcia's Calima (he is said to be the next Ferran Adria - cherry gazpacho with anchovies and queso fresco snow), in the Hotel Gran Melia Don Pepe. The town is home to over 600 more eateries, making it one of Andalucia's top culinary destinations. For smart dinners, Puerto Banus and the Golden Mile are the place to go, while trendier beachfront venues line the Paseo Maritimo. Down to earth tapas can be found in the atmospheric casco antiguo.
